[libc-commits] [libc] [libc] Add AMDGPU Timing to CMake (PR #99603)

via libc-commits libc-commits at lists.llvm.org
Thu Jul 18 21:09:07 PDT 2024


llvmbot wrote:


<!--LLVM PR SUMMARY COMMENT-->

@llvm/pr-subscribers-libc

Author: None (jameshu15869)

<details>
<summary>Changes</summary>

`libc/benchmarks/gpu/timing/CMakeLists.txt` did not correctly build `amdgpu` utils. This PR fixes that issue by adding `amdgpu` to the loop that adds the correct sub directories. 

---
Full diff: https://github.com/llvm/llvm-project/pull/99603.diff


1 Files Affected:

- (modified) libc/benchmarks/gpu/timing/CMakeLists.txt (+1-1) 


``````````diff
diff --git a/libc/benchmarks/gpu/timing/CMakeLists.txt b/libc/benchmarks/gpu/timing/CMakeLists.txt
index 8bbc7e33f122a..b6d84607aa607 100644
--- a/libc/benchmarks/gpu/timing/CMakeLists.txt
+++ b/libc/benchmarks/gpu/timing/CMakeLists.txt
@@ -1,4 +1,4 @@
-foreach(target nvptx)
+foreach(target nvptx amdgpu)
   add_subdirectory(${target})
   list(APPEND target_gpu_timing libc.benchmarks.gpu.timing.${target}.${target}_timing)
 endforeach()

``````````

</details>


https://github.com/llvm/llvm-project/pull/99603


More information about the libc-commits mailing list